Rainbow Chamber Singers, a Shanghai-based group known for popularizing chamber choir music among young Chinese, took the crown as winners of the reality show We Are Blazing, produced by Tencent Video, on July 23.

The reality show, the first of its kind in the country with Chinese musical groups in competition, premiered on May 29. Besides the Rainbow Chamber Singers, other popular Chinese musical groups, including RiSE and Rocket Girls, also joined in the show.

In 2010, Jin Chengzhi, who majored in conducting at the Shanghai Conservatory of Music, co-founded the choir along with his classmates at the university. Now, with an average age of 24, the group consists of young people from all walks of life and has gained a large fan base with their original works, which are known for their catchy rhythms and humorous lyrics, including Where On Earth Did You Leave the Key to My Apartment, Zhang Shichao?
